Class SourceIssuesIssueTarget

java.lang.Object
net.officefloor.compile.impl.structure.SourceIssuesIssueTarget
All Implemented Interfaces:
IssueTarget

public class SourceIssuesIssueTarget extends Object implements IssueTarget
Adapts the SourceIssues to IssueTarget.
Author:
Daniel Sagenschneider
  • Constructor Details

    • SourceIssuesIssueTarget

      public SourceIssuesIssueTarget(SourceIssues sourceIssues)
      Instantiate.
      Parameters:
      sourceIssues - SourceIssues.
  • Method Details

    • addIssue

      public void addIssue(String issueDescription)
      Description copied from interface: IssueTarget
      Adds the issue.
      Specified by:
      addIssue in interface IssueTarget
      Parameters:
      issueDescription - Description of the issue.
    • addIssue

      public void addIssue(String issueDescription, Throwable cause)
      Description copied from interface: IssueTarget
      Adds the issue.
      Specified by:
      addIssue in interface IssueTarget
      Parameters:
      issueDescription - Description of the issue.
      cause - Cause of the issue.